Prevalence and prognostic implications of malnutrition as defined by GLIM criteria in elderly patients with heart failure

This study aimed to determine the prevalence and prognostic implication of malnutrition as defined by GLIM criteria in comparison to those for a pre-existing definition of malnutrition, the geriatric nutritional risk index (GNRI), in elderly patients with heart failure
